Abstract
We have proposed a novel Estimation of Distribution Algorithm for solving reinforcement learning problems: EDA-RL. The EDA-RL can perform well if the complexity of the structure of the probabilistic model is adapted to the difficulty of given problems. Therefore, this paper proposes a structure search method of the probabilistic model in the EDA-RL as in conventional EDA taking account multivariate dependencies. Moreover, a data correction method by eliminating loops of state transitions is also proposed. Computational simulations on maze problems, which have several perceptual aliasing states, show the effectiveness of the proposed method.
